The Southeastern Louisiana University student organization Reconnect is hosting a farmers market on Wednesday, Feb. 19, from 10 a.m. – 2 p.m. in front of the Student Union. Fresh produce, barbecue chicken, hot tamales, crawfish pies, specialty pies, lavender soda, chocolate flavored coffee and more will be featured at the farmers market. Vendors will have specialty treats and homemade jellies. Local crafters and artisans will have pottery, handmaid knits and handcrafted jewelry. Attendees can also expect live music. The organization will host two more farmers markets this semester at the same time and location on Wednesday, March 18 and Wednesday, April 22. A student environmental club, Reconnect participates in the Real Food Challenge, a national effort among college students to promote the use of locally grown, healthy and sustainable food products.
